
Decorative Wireless Chime
6180 Series, 6270 Series, and 6280 Series
This package includes (Style of push button and chime may vary from illustra- tions):
•Wireless chime
•Wireless push button w/battery
•Hardware pack
You'll need to buy 3 "D" alkaline batteries for the chime. In typical use,
alkaline batteries will last up to three years.
Figure 1
1. Install alkaline type A23 12 volt push button battery. Re- move back of case by pushing in tab on bottom with a small screwdriver (see Figure 1). Make sure battery is oriented properly (See page 4).
2. Install 3 alkaline“D”batteries.

Make sure batteries are oriented properly (see Figure 2).
3.Test range. Temporarily posi- tion chime and push button where you want them mounted. Press push button to verify chime and push button work properly. If chime does not sound, see Troubleshooting.
